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
090020686 17287 32 811677286 09462
33261560 38
33261560 38
296 67471050 881
All about undefined
Interested in learning more?
33261560 38
296 67471050 881
See more
467 328660
826 9332542 8335
See more
043 03
643 9010048 856 088827481
See more